Course Details

School Time Management: Understanding the importance of time management in a school setting, including strategies for effective planning and organization.
Prioritization Techniques: Learning how to prioritize tasks and activities to make the most of available time, including methods for determining urgency and importance.
Creating Efficient Schedules: Techniques for creating efficient and manageable schedules, including the use of technology and tools for scheduling and time tracking.
Overcoming Time Management Challenges: Addressing common challenges in school time management, such as procrastination, distractions, and multitasking.
Effective Communication: Understanding the role of communication in time management, including strategies for clear and concise communication with students, parents, and colleagues.
Building a Time Management Culture: Developing a culture of time management within a school, including strategies for promoting time management skills among students and staff.
Monitoring and Evaluation: Techniques for monitoring and evaluating time management practices, including the use of data and feedback to inform continuous improvement.
